DevOps Software Engineer

Prophasys LLC

$150K — $240K *
Aerospace & Defense
5 - 7 years of experience
Job Overview by Ladders

Qualifications

  • 5-7 years of experience in DevOps roles with a strong focus in Linux environments
  • Proficient in scripting languages, particularly Shell, Bash, and Python
  • Demonstrated experience in Linux administration including software integration and management
  • Experience in deploying and maintaining COTS/GOTS/FOSS software solutions
  • Strong software development experience in Java and Python
  • Familiarity with CI/CD tools and practices, particularly GitLab CI
  • Active TS/SCI with Polygraph security clearance required.

Responsibilities

  • Lead software integration efforts and framework development for HPC systems
  • Maintain automated infrastructure solutions to ensure system uptime
  • Collaborate with stakeholders to optimize deployment pipelines
  • Enhance system performance by implementing best practices
  • Support and automate infrastructure provisioning and configuration management
  • Utilize containerization technologies for deploying microservices
  • Monitor system performance and health using tools like Prometheus/Grafana.

Benefits

  • Comprehensive health, dental, and vision coverage
  • Paid time off and holidays
  • Retirement savings plans
  • Employer-paid life and disability insurance
  • Training and tuition reimbursement programs
  • Year-end discretionary bonus eligibility
  • Employee recognition awards.
Full Job Description
The DevOps Software Engineer shall be responsible for software integration efforts, development of framework solutions, and maintaining automated infrastructure solutions to ensure high availability and scalability of HPC systems in a Linux environment. In this role, the DevOps Software Engineer shall work closely with various stakeholders to streamline the deployment pipeline and optimize system performance. Experience with the Atlassian Toll Suite (JIRA, Confluence) is preferred.
  • Experience with Linux CLI
  • Experience writing scripts using Shell/Bash/Python
  • Linux administration experience including software integration, service management,
  • configuration management, and routine sustainment operations related to provisioning,
  • storage, and networking.
  • Experience installing, configuring, and supporting COTS/GOTS/FOSS software,
  • libraries, and packages in a Linux environment
  • Extensive software development experience with Java and Python
  • Experience with stream/batch Big Data processing and analytic frameworks
  • Experience with CI/CD principles, methodologies, and tools such as GitLab CI
  • Experience with IaC (Infrastructure as Code) principles and automation infrastructure
  • provisioning and configuration using tools such as Ansible
  • Experience with containerization technologies such as Docker
  • Experience deploying containerized services under Kubernetes orchestration
  • Demonstrated experience using system monitoring tools such as Prometheus/Grafana
  • Experience with Git for source code management, branching strategies, and team
  • collaboration

Compensation & Benefits - We offer a highly competitive salary along with a full benefits package, including paid time off, health/dental/vision coverage, retirement savings plans, employer paid life and disability, training and tuition reimbursement and more. This position is eligible for our year end discretionary bonus plan, as well as recognition awards. The competitive salary range* is $150,000 to $240,000 (annualized USD).

* Salary ranges are intended as a guideline, not a guarantee of pay. Final compensation is determined after a thorough review of multiple factors such as job level, responsibilities, geographic location, relevant work experience, educational background, certifications, contract-specific considerations, organizational needs, and alignment with current market conditions. Please note that these ranges may be adjusted over time and should be viewed as estimates rather than fixed amounts.

Prophasys, LLC provides equal employment opportunities (EEO) to all qualified applicants for employment without regard to race, color, religion, sex, national origin, age, disability, genetic information, military or veteran status or any other status protected by law.

Prophasys is required to notify all applicants of their rights pursuant to federal employment laws. For further information, please review the Know Your Rights notice (6/27/2023 version) from the Department of Labor.

Prophasys participates in E-Verify and will provide the federal government with I-9 information to confirm that all new hires are authorized to work in the U.S. To learn more about E-Verify please visit https://www.e-verify.gov/about-e-verify

Requirements

Security Clearance - Applicants must hold an active TS/SCI with Polygraph.

Education/Experience Requirements - Bachelor's degree in Computer Science, Computer Engineering, or a closely related field is required. Positions that may be available range from mid- level (7-14 years) to subject matter expert level (20+ years).

Similar Jobs

More Aerospace & Defense Jobs

Find similar DevOps Software Engineer jobs: